# Build Provenance — Fablewick Test-Data Factory

Every Fablewick release is built from a tagged commit on the provenance runner; no manual uploads are accepted. Support can confirm a customer's version matches an attested build by checking the manifest. If a customer reports fixture drift, first verify their library came from our pipeline. Compare their installed version against the token below.

session token of yajof-bagef = htk4_937d

Handover Note — Director Transition, Subscription Strategy

To my successor: the launch of the new Emberline Plus tier is the most sensitive item you inherit. Pricing has been validated through two rounds of panel research; the feature split between Standard and Plus is agreed, though Engineering wants one more sprint on the analytics module. Legal has cleared the revised terms. Do not brief partners until the board signs off — timing matters commercially here. The confidential outline of our plans follows immediately below.

management briefing: Project Ulavan slips by two quarters because of the staffing delay.

Welcome aboard! SquatterWatch, our typo-squatting package scanner, is deliberately throttled so we don't hammer the upstream registries and get ourselves blocked. There are per-registry request caps, a candidate-name fan-out limit per seed package, and a daily budget for deep scans (the ones that actually download tarballs). Please don't bump anything without pinging the platform channel first. The limits currently enforced in config are these.

constants for bawif-kawif:
QUOTAS = {
    "ulaael": 5,
    "holael": 10,
}